ingredients
- 2 tablespoons black peppercorns
- 2 tablespoons cumin seeds
- 2 tablespoons oregano, dried
- 1⁄2 cup salt, coarse (kosher or sea)
- 2 tablespoons garlic powder
-
OPTIONAL ADDITIONS
- dried citrus zest (orange, lemon or lime)
- saffron
- achiote powder
directions
- To toast the peppercorns and cumin seeds, heat a small nonstick skillet over medium heat for 1 minute. Place whole spices in the skillet and stir until very fragrant and the color of the cumin begins to deepen (be careful not to overcook or burn). Remove from heat and cool. Use a mortar and pestle or coffee grinder to grind into powder.
- Mix all ingredients together; store in covered container.
